FILE: Rock Hudson Guidelines (Letter)

This historical item from this series is an inter-office letter about guidelines for Rock Hudson’s tour for the film, “Pretty Maids All In A Row.” View the letter above or after the link bump read the full text of it.

Full Text of Letter:

INTER-OFFICE COMMUNICATION

TO: ALL ADVERTISING AND PROMOTION MANAGERS

SUBJECT: “PRETTY MAIDS ALL IN A ROW”

FROM: DAVID McGRATH

DATE: FEB. 24, 1971

I have attached a list of cities that Rock Hudson, Barbara Leigh, and the “Pretty Maids” will tour in conjunction with “Pretty Maids All In A Row.” In addition to these THIRTY cities, Angie Dickinson, Gene Roddenberry, and Roger Vadim are scheduled to go to Atlanta, Georgia for the World Premiere on Wednesday, March 24.

The following are guidelines to setting up various tours:

ROCK HUDSON

Hotel: Two bedroom suite for him and Glen Shahan (unit publicist on “Pretty Maids”)
Plaza Hotel, New York
Ambassador, Chicago
No preference in other cities

Transportation: Limousine

Liquor: Tanqueray Gin, J. & B. Scotch, Old Grand-dad Bourbon

Press: Prefers Press Luncheons. However, will do individual interviews with key papers, columnists and College Press Seminars.

Radio: Interviews in Suite, except for network.

TV: Prefers one TV show per city; however, will do three-four minute newsclip at airport or hotel upon arrival, etc.

Promotion: Set contest with top 40 stations for “Pretty Maids” to send in name and photo. Winner has lunch with Rock at Press conference; photos, receives outfit as worn by “Pretty Maids” in April issue of MADEMOISELLE from House of Nine Stores plus screening of picture for her and runners-up.

(No Activities After 6:00pm)
